The Digital Forensics Forum (DFF) is the world's first organization of professionals, leading experts and emerging talents in IT Security, Risk Analysis, Digital Forensics, Security Operation Center management and Lawful Interception. Together they work to fight cybercrime, fraud, various criminal activities and terrorism in the digital world. By sharing strategies, technologies and workflows, the relationships between these key disciplines can be leveraged to ensure the most effective solutions are developed. (More.....)
